United Automobile Celebrates sales centre’s second anniversary

Malta Independent Tuesday, 1 March 2005, 00:00 Last update: about 13 years ago

United Automobile Limited is celebrating the second anniversary of the opening of its new after sales service centre in Lija. The new centre, apart from offering Opel and Saab drivers, a state of the art facility, has been developed with the customer in mind and has also led to a significant increase in efficiency.

“United Automobile Limited offers Opel and Saab drivers one of the most advanced after sales service centres in Malta. Equipped with the latest diagnostic tools and with a staff complement trained by Opel and Saab, our centre offers an unrivalled ability to service cars as well as to pinpoint and solve any difficulties which might arise. The quality of the facilities at our after sales service centre not only helps our customers to enjoy the use of their cars but also contributes to maintaining a high resale value ,” said Mr Edmund Gatt Baldacchino, United Automobile’s Managing Director.

The United Automobile Limited after sales centre opened in March 2003. The centre, apart from technical excellence, also provides Opel drivers with access to a well stocked modern warehouse. United Automobile are in direct contact with Opel/Saab warehouses and assure original parts are delivered on a weekly basis, ensuring customers do not have to wait unduly for any repairs which may be necessary.

“Potential car buyers are aware that a high level of after sales service is as important as ensuring that the car they purchase meets their needs and expectations. The new after sales centre in Lija represented a significant investment for United but the results, in terms of the quality of service which we are now able to offer, have certainly justified this decision. In the two years since opening more than 12,000 vehicles were serviced at our after sales centre in Lija. Our commitment is to serve our customers better, thus ensuring customers will consider purchasing another vehicle from United.

The new premises also house a training centre. United believes that its human resources is vital in maintaining a customer focused mission. Continuous training which are based on Opel/Saab concepts are a must for all employees. Only in this manner can we make sure that we keep updated with the latest technological and engineering changes,” concluded Mr Gatt Baldacchino.
